Subject: Welcome — Stocktally reconciliation on-call notes

Hi, and welcome to the rotation. The Stocktally job reconciles warehouse counts against the Ordanet ledger nightly at 02:00. Plugin authors: your adapters run inside this job, so a thrown error there pages whoever is on call. Please validate inputs and return structured failures rather than raising. Most pages are caused by malformed adapter output, and the fix is usually a plugin-side patch. The adapter contract, retry semantics, and escalation path are documented here.

operations page: https://jenkins.zemvarcloud.local/job/merge_requests/repo/build/73930b4b30f0a8ed

Ticket #4421 — Upgrade Relaypost broker

The Relaypost message broker on the Corvid cluster needs upgrading to the 7.x line before queue mirroring is deprecated. Expect a 10-minute consumer pause during the rolling restart. Support should hold related tickets until the upgrade window closes. Reference the trace token below when filing follow-ups.

pipeline stamp: htk6_7941f2

## Runbook: Metryx sidecar not reporting

Hey, new folks — the Metryx sidecar aggregates metrics from every Harborline service pod and ships them upstream in 30-second windows. If dashboards go flat, first check whether the sidecar container is alive, then whether it can reach the aggregation endpoint. Nine times out of ten it's a bad flush interval or a stale endpoint after a redeploy. Restart it once; if that doesn't fix things, verify its settings. The sidecar's expected configuration values are listed below.

service settings:
novath:
  pin: 1396
  tenant: pelys
  seal: seal_ccc035e1
  metrics_host: metrics.novath.qorvelworks.test
  standby_team: fraeth
  escalation: drueth-zorok
  nonce: 61d508